If you want to spend a few days in one of the most beautiful cities of the world and rent an apartment, rather stay at a hotel, then there is no better option than the No 46 Prague.
No 46? No 1 more like. It’s habitually voted the number one vacation rental by guides and it is easy to see why.
It is an outstanding 19th century apartment that manages to be discreet within the stunning location of Vinohrady, Prague’s most affluent area, no less, and only a ten minute walk from the city’s best known landmark of Wenceslas Square.
As you can see from the pictures, this is also a classy accommodation, wonderfully and stylishly decorated by James and his wife Jo (interior designers and interior photographers by profession – and it shows).
Their superb taste mixes total taste with creative inspiration and total attention to detail. Interiors offers elegance and stimulation, from rustic heirlooms to the giant photographs of the stunningly beautiful city of Prague adorning its walls.
We finish as we started. No. 46 offers a fantastic base for getting to know one of the most stunning cities in the world.

Things to do in Vinohrady
Vinohrady is one of the most elegant residential neighbourhoods in Prague. During the 19th century, the landscape was covered in rose gardens, orchards and vineyards (vinohrady) running down the gentle slope towards the River Vltava and the centre of Prague.
Vinohrady is now one of the most stylish districts in the city, its broad tree-lined boulevards and colourful squares offering an exceptional array of architectural styles from Neo-Renaissance and Art Nouveau to Pseudo Baroque and Neo-Gothic. Within these doors are to be found some of the hippest and exciting cafes, bars, restaurants and clubs in Europe.
The district’s charming Riegrovy-sady and Havlíčkovy-sady parks provide a very pleasant relief from the sometimes maddening crowds of the centre. One could quite happily while away a few days just hanging out in Vinorady alone – although, of course, that would be missing the bigger picture.
The city centre is extremely easy to reach – either three metro stops on the A-line or two subway stations on Tram 11, or just an undemanding ten minute stroll through some of the most spectacular streetscapes of Prague.
Five things to do in Vinohrady
Spend a sunny evening in the beer garden in Riegrovy Sady
Have a glass of wine in the folly midst fabulous vineyards in Havlickovy Sady
Relax on a bench or on the grass, people-watching in Namesti Miru
Take a stroll up Manesova, popping into the numerous antique shops and cafés
See a play at the Vinohrady theatre in Namesti Miru
